Skills
Mathematics
Probabilities & Statistics
Probability Distributions
Bayesian Inference
Hypothesis Testing
Stochastic Process
Discrete Markov Chain
Continuous Markov Chain
Poisson processes
Renewal processes
Data Mining
Decision Tree
k-means
Hierarchical Clustering
Neural Network
Data Visualization
Computer Science
Fundamentals
Data Structures
Algorithms
Design Patterns
Operating Systems
Database System
Programming Languages
VBA
C++
Java
MATLAB
R
SQL
LaTex
HTML5
CSS3
javascript
SAS
Languages
English
Mandarin
Cantonese
Internship
Beijing Genomic Institute
RNA Regulation Network Construction
May.2013-Aug.2013
-
Process data of human RNA expression from MAQC( MicroArray Quality Control ) in a predefined format
-
Implement the algorithms on mutual information , direct information under Gaussian Mixture model in C++
-
mprove the computation efficiency by 50% faster with GNU Scientific Library C++ API in Linux
Projects
Sep.2014-May.2015
Kernel Based Principal Component Analysis
-
Deduce the rationale of kernel method , analyze convergence , and implement methods in MATLAB
-
Compare and analyze the performance of parameterized polynomial and Gaussian kernel functions
-
Employ the kernel PCA (the Bag of Words model) on text to reduce data dimensionality
Jan.2014-March.2015
Brownian Motion in Stock Price Simulation
-
Simulate the behavior of the stock price with Random walk and Geometrical Brownian Motion in VBA
-
Analyze the volatility parameters and estimate the confidence interval in Geometrical Brownian Motion
-
Examine the short term and long term prediction of stock price data